Transfer Success

Institutional Effectiveness > Institutional Research > Student Achievement Goals > Transfer Success

Virginia Western measures transfer success by examining students in the previous academic year to determine if the student had subsequently enrolled at a four-year institution in the next academic year. For example, all students enrolled at VWCC in the academic year 2019-2020 were examined in 2020-2021 to determine if they had subsequently enrolled at a 4-year institution.

1. Subsequent Enrollment at 4-Year Institutions – All Students

Goal/Target: The percentage of Virginia Western students that subsequently enroll at a 4-year institution within one year will increase by 1% from the prior year.

Threshold of Acceptability: The percentage of Virginia Western students that subsequently enroll within one year will be maintained from the prior year.

Source: National Student Clearinghouse

Frequency of Assessment: Annually

All subsequent transfer students
all subsequent transfer students graph

Conclusion: 19% of all Virginia Western students enrolled in the 2020-21 academic year subsequently enrolled the next year. This is a decrease of 1% from the prior year; thus, we did not meet our threshold of acceptability.

Action Plan: This population includes our career technical education students who are enrolled in programs designed for immediate employment. The Academic Success Team, part of our Shared Governance structure, along with the VCCS, is finalizing the Transfer Virginia Program. This will allow for a seamless transfer to four-year institutions. This program begins in 2023-2024.


2. Subsequent Enrollment at 4-Year Institutions – Transfer Graduates*

Goal/Target: 53% of all Virginia Western transfer graduates will subsequently enroll at a 4-year institution within one year.

Threshold of Acceptability: 50% of all Virginia Western transfer graduates will subsequently enroll at a 4-year institution within one year.

Source: National Student Clearinghouse

Frequency of Assessment: Annually

* Any student that graduates from VWCC with an Associate of Arts or Associate of Science degree

Transfer Graduates that Subsequently Enroll Table
VWCC Graduates that Subsequently Enroll

Conclusion: 55% of 2020-2021 transfer graduates subsequently enrolled at a four-year institution within one year. This meets our goal of 53%.
